Job Description: The Public Health Nurse translates knowledge from the health and social sciences to support health-enhancing behaviors of individuals, families and population groups through targeted interventions, programs, and advocacy. Inherent in this role are knowledge, skills, and abilities specific to health promotion, prevention, and protection. This employee focuses on the immunization program for adults, high risk individuals and international travelers and works relatively independently. This employee is expected to make decisions based on sound assessments high risk individuals and international travelers and works relatively independently. This employee is expected to make decisions based on sound assessments in accordance with The Public Health Act, the policies of the Public Health Nursing program and the Health Region, the CRNS Standards of Practice, the Canadian Community Health Nursing Standards of Practice, and other relevant legislation. This employee liaises with, and refers to, other health personnel, other sectors and community groups. The Public Health Nurse works within guidelines established by Health Region policy to plan, organize, implement and evaluate nursing programs in an assigned area, under the direction and supervision of a Public Health Nursing supervisor.
